Output 621fe7afc6ccdc3d9be65c592ed617a820433dff8f3df830071610fb1ca223c6:1

value
838859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4ac04f8ac6bedad2bccd1fd30fe355f9b6adf0 OP_EQUAL
address
3FwQtGtHNTMzm6K21zPX7krCFvCxVVrpF1
transaction
621fe7afc6ccdc3d9be65c592ed617a820433dff8f3df830071610fb1ca223c6
spent
true